Advanced Information Infrastructure: Building Block for the Knowledge Economy
Advanced information and communication networks and services, both wireline and wireless, form an infrastructure that is critical to the prosperity of communities, states, and nations. This half-day conference reviews the state of advanced information infrastructure with a particular emphasis on Michigan and assesses the state's readiness to manage the transition from an industrial to a knowledge-based economy. From the Kellogg Center at Michigan State University.
